摘要
文章针对某传统发动机车型改款为48 V轻混车型所产生的低速小油门加速开空调车内啸叫问题进行研究,并确定啸叫声源自压缩机工作激励。阐述压缩机啸叫声向整车的传递路径原理,找出压缩机啸叫向车内传递以空气声为主。最终采用降低压缩机速比至1.22且压缩机皮带轮重量增加至815 g的方案,使压缩机引起的车内啸叫得到明显改善。
